DTC : P0138 (2020): General Description

The rear secondary heated oxygen sensor (secondary HO2S (bank 1, sensor 2)) detects the oxygen content in the exhaust gas downstream of the rear warm up three way catalytic converter (WU-TWC) (bank 1) during stoichiometric air/fuel ratio feedback control. The powertrain control module (PCM) controls the air/fuel ratio from the rear air/fuel ratio (A/F) sensor (bank 1, sensor 1) output voltage so that the rear WU-TWC (bank 1) efficiency is optimized. When power is applied to the rear secondary HO2S (bank 1, sensor 2) heater, if the rear secondary HO2S (bank 1, sensor 2) output voltage is high or the SO2SGB1 terminal voltage is high during feedback control, the PCM detects a malfunction and stores a DTC.
